Review: To Keep A Secret by Brenda Chapman

This is another novel by Brenda Chapman about PI Anna Sweet.

Anna's partner, Jada Price is missing and it's up to her and the new hire at the company, Nick Roma to find her.  When Jada is found (hiding out with her teenage brother, Henry) Anna is in the middle of a new mystery, the murder of teenager Mandy Blair and a secret internet dating site.   Anna needs to work pretty quickly. Henry's life depends on it.

Once again Brenda Chapman does a great job of developing characters in a relatively short amount of time.  We revisit some repeat characters like Anna and her father and sister, Jimmy who was first Anna's fiance and ended up married to her sister, and get to learn more about Jada who Anna teamed up with at the end of "My Sister's Keeper"  and the mysterious newly hired Nick.

I was able to figure out one part of the story relatively early but then there was an unexpected twist that made everything more exciting.  Chapman has a style of writing that just kept me interested and wanting to read the story faster to find out what was going to happen.  Another really great, quick read, 2 big thumbs up!
